#429e51 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#429e51 is composed of 25.9% red, 62%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 48.7%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 129.8 degrees, a saturation of 41.1% and a lightness of 43.9%. #429e51 color hex could be obtained by blending #84ffa2 with #003d00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#429e51
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020603 is the darkest color, while #f7fc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#429e51
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6d736e is the less saturated color, while #06da28 is the most saturated one.
